Neuware - 'Rita Mookerjee's False Offering, while providing a trenchant critique of the oppressiveness of 'white space,' is also glittery, culinary sumptuous, and scythe sharp. Shot through with equal parts 'nectar and venom,' Mookerjee's poems pirouette with muscular grace in a kaleidoscopic whirl of myth and alchemy, gods and feasts, rot and rose gold. False Offering is a feminist ledger of 'battle armor meeting ballet.' Like a medieval tapestry, it is piped through with an elaborate galaxy of nightviolets, rosewater, bonedust, 'snakes and shibari,' origami, and the KKK. It is a rare book in that even while flipping the middle finger; it has its hands held out in tenderness to those in need.' --Simone Muench, Poetry Editor, JackLeg Pres.

It isn't a showy blossom; it is an odd appendage that you could miss if you were not actively seeking it. The poems in Banana Heart exemplify that which gets overlooked in the context of race, culture, and the tourist economy. Mookerjee explores the social practices of travel, sex, and survival for queer people of color living in diaspora. This collection places an emphasis on form (ranging from the abecedarian, aubade, elegy, and kyrielle to the nocturne, ode, and sestina) seizing once-colonial modes of writing and infusing them with erotic queer brown potential.
